    Carva is the best RB Spain ever produced. Wasn't selected in 2014 WC despite being the best RB that season, then missed Euro 2016 and World Cup 2018 after getting injured in CL finals. Terrible luck.

    Glad he won Euro 2024 to have an achievement with NT too after 6 CLs with RM. If a Spanish player had to win BDR based on trophies that season, should have been Carva. MOTM in CL final too.

    Juanfran and Azpili were selected ahead of Carva. VDB was loyal to his guys. Carva had Ribery in his pocket during both legs of CL semis and got snubbed like that from WC squad. 2013-14 was one of the best club seasons in Carva's overall career too.

    Like renew with 40 ME clause last summer? That was possible. But then he has to make the hard decision of giving up 25-30 ME in signing bonus.

    Heard Davies renewed with a big signing bonus at Bayern. Leaving for a transfer fee and pocketing big sighing bonus isn't an option in such situations. Trent either had to renew with Pool to stay long-term for a big signing bonus or choose free agent option.

    Making sure Pool get 40 ME while sacrificing 25-30 ME signing bonus for himself. I guess very few players would do that even with childhood club affection.
